999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

局域網(wǎng)網(wǎng)絡(luò)流量捕獲方法分析

2012-04-29 00:44:03許文民
軟件工程 2012年11期

許文民

摘要:網(wǎng)絡(luò)流量捕獲對(duì)網(wǎng)絡(luò)分析有著十分重要的作用,特別是隨著網(wǎng)絡(luò)技術(shù)的發(fā)展與網(wǎng)絡(luò)需求的增加,都對(duì)網(wǎng)絡(luò)流量捕獲提出了更高的要求。本文對(duì)網(wǎng)絡(luò)流量捕獲的意義進(jìn)行了分析,并分析了網(wǎng)絡(luò)流量捕獲方法。

關(guān)鍵詞:網(wǎng)絡(luò)流量;數(shù)據(jù)包;數(shù)據(jù)包捕獲

隨著網(wǎng)絡(luò)技術(shù)的快速發(fā)展與網(wǎng)絡(luò)需求的空前增加,網(wǎng)絡(luò)用戶數(shù)量與網(wǎng)絡(luò)應(yīng)用的快速增長(zhǎng)導(dǎo)致了網(wǎng)絡(luò)的性能下降。因此,對(duì)網(wǎng)絡(luò)性能進(jìn)行優(yōu)化、合理利用網(wǎng)絡(luò)資源已經(jīng)成為了人們普遍關(guān)注的焦點(diǎn)問題。網(wǎng)絡(luò)流量捕獲技術(shù)是對(duì)網(wǎng)絡(luò)性能進(jìn)行綜合評(píng)估的重要基礎(chǔ),因此對(duì)網(wǎng)絡(luò)流量捕獲技術(shù)進(jìn)行研究焊絲優(yōu)化網(wǎng)絡(luò)性能、提高網(wǎng)絡(luò)利用率的重要措施。

一、網(wǎng)絡(luò)流量捕獲的意義

對(duì)網(wǎng)絡(luò)流量進(jìn)行捕獲、分析,能發(fā)現(xiàn)網(wǎng)絡(luò)的瓶頸,對(duì)網(wǎng)絡(luò)的優(yōu)化打下良好基礎(chǔ)。網(wǎng)絡(luò)流量捕獲是網(wǎng)絡(luò)流量分析的重要基礎(chǔ),能夠明確網(wǎng)絡(luò)流量的變化,反映出在網(wǎng)絡(luò)運(yùn)行過程中所存在的故障、性能以及其他多個(gè)方面的信息。要準(zhǔn)確的明確網(wǎng)絡(luò)運(yùn)行的可靠性等信息,制定出科學(xué)合理的網(wǎng)絡(luò)性能優(yōu)化方案,就必須要對(duì)網(wǎng)絡(luò)運(yùn)行的歷史進(jìn)行定量化的記錄。網(wǎng)絡(luò)流量捕獲是對(duì)網(wǎng)絡(luò)運(yùn)行歷史進(jìn)行定量化記錄的重要手段,同時(shí)網(wǎng)絡(luò)流量捕獲也是對(duì)網(wǎng)絡(luò)進(jìn)行測(cè)量的重要手段。

隨著網(wǎng)絡(luò)規(guī)模的擴(kuò)大,各種網(wǎng)絡(luò)應(yīng)用在不斷地增加,與此同時(shí)網(wǎng)絡(luò)的異構(gòu)性以及復(fù)雜性都在不斷的提高,而人們對(duì)網(wǎng)絡(luò)性能的滿意程度卻并沒有相應(yīng)的增高。當(dāng)前人們期望的是網(wǎng)絡(luò)能夠同時(shí)滿足高可靠性和高性能這兩方面的要求。因此,就需要設(shè)計(jì)出高速IP網(wǎng)絡(luò)流量捕獲監(jiān)測(cè)技術(shù),通過這種檢測(cè)技術(shù)來對(duì)高效網(wǎng)絡(luò)協(xié)議進(jìn)行分析,并開發(fā)出具有更高性能的網(wǎng)絡(luò)設(shè)備,并通過流量工程來改善網(wǎng)絡(luò)負(fù)載,使其變得更加的合理,并保證關(guān)鍵業(yè)務(wù)的性能。這些都需要對(duì)各層協(xié)議的詳細(xì)情況進(jìn)行定量的了解,其中包括了網(wǎng)絡(luò)流量與業(yè)務(wù)流的使用分布、增長(zhǎng)趨勢(shì)等等。通過對(duì)這些信息的了解,進(jìn)而能夠建立起精確的網(wǎng)絡(luò)流量模型和業(yè)務(wù)流量、性能模型,這樣能夠更好的發(fā)現(xiàn)影響或者限制網(wǎng)絡(luò)性能的關(guān)鍵問題[1]。

二、網(wǎng)絡(luò)數(shù)據(jù)包捕獲技術(shù)分析

(一)數(shù)據(jù)包捕獲基本原理

物理基礎(chǔ):以太網(wǎng)本身具有共享介質(zhì)的特征,信息是以明文的凡是在網(wǎng)絡(luò)上進(jìn)行傳輸,當(dāng)網(wǎng)絡(luò)適配器設(shè)置為監(jiān)聽模式時(shí),因?yàn)槭遣捎玫囊蕴W(wǎng)廣播信道征用的方式,這就能夠讓監(jiān)聽系統(tǒng)與正常的通信網(wǎng)絡(luò)系統(tǒng)進(jìn)行并聯(lián)連接,并且還能夠捕獲任何一個(gè)在同一個(gè)沖突領(lǐng)域中所傳輸?shù)臄?shù)據(jù)。

數(shù)據(jù)包捕獲的前提:每一臺(tái)網(wǎng)絡(luò)上的主機(jī)都擁有一個(gè)唯一的物理地址,通過物理地址就能夠找到網(wǎng)絡(luò)上的任何一臺(tái)主機(jī)。在共享式的網(wǎng)絡(luò)中,每一個(gè)主機(jī)所發(fā)送的數(shù)據(jù)報(bào),處于同一個(gè)網(wǎng)絡(luò)中的其余主機(jī)都能夠接收到。主機(jī)上網(wǎng)卡的首要任務(wù)就是對(duì)當(dāng)前總線的狀態(tài)進(jìn)行不斷的探測(cè),如果當(dāng)前網(wǎng)絡(luò)中有數(shù)據(jù)傳輸,那么就對(duì)所流經(jīng)的數(shù)據(jù)包進(jìn)行判斷分析,如果數(shù)據(jù)包中的目的地址與本機(jī)的不符就將該數(shù)據(jù)幀丟棄,否則就接收。而工作在混雜模式下的網(wǎng)卡則能夠接受所有流經(jīng)該網(wǎng)卡的數(shù)據(jù)幀,因此,要捕獲數(shù)據(jù)包,其前提就是將網(wǎng)卡設(shè)置在混雜模式下。

(二)BPF機(jī)制與Libpeap函數(shù)庫

BPF是S.Mceanne和V.Jaeobson等人所推出的包過濾器。BPF由網(wǎng)絡(luò)分接頭與數(shù)據(jù)過濾器所組成,其中,網(wǎng)絡(luò)分接頭是一個(gè)函數(shù),其主要用于網(wǎng)絡(luò)數(shù)據(jù)流。數(shù)據(jù)過濾器則是BPF的核心部分,用戶能夠通過對(duì)數(shù)據(jù)過濾器設(shè)置過濾規(guī)則,來捕獲自己所感興趣的所有數(shù)據(jù)包子集,其工作機(jī)制如圖1所示[2]:

Libpep是由Berkeiey大學(xué)的Van Jacobson、Steven McCanne和Craig Leres所開發(fā)的,是應(yīng)用在Linux平臺(tái)下的,用來對(duì)網(wǎng)絡(luò)數(shù)據(jù)包進(jìn)行捕獲的跨平臺(tái)編程接口,是一個(gè)獨(dú)立于系統(tǒng)的、用戶層數(shù)據(jù)包捕獲函數(shù)庫。因?yàn)槭枪ぷ髟谟脩魧?,所以?duì)操作系統(tǒng)細(xì)節(jié)進(jìn)行了隱藏,使用更加的方便,其主要包括了三個(gè)部分:最底層是針對(duì)硬件設(shè)備接口的數(shù)據(jù)包捕獲機(jī)制,中間是針對(duì)內(nèi)核級(jí)的包過濾機(jī)制,最后一層是針對(duì)用戶程序的接口。

(三)數(shù)據(jù)包捕獲工作流程

數(shù)據(jù)包捕獲流程主要有以下幾個(gè)方面:(1)對(duì)主機(jī)網(wǎng)絡(luò)機(jī)構(gòu)列表進(jìn)行查找,并選擇可用網(wǎng)絡(luò)接口;(2)進(jìn)行初始化,必須要對(duì)實(shí)行數(shù)據(jù)包捕獲的設(shè)備進(jìn)行設(shè)置;(3)對(duì)過濾器進(jìn)行設(shè)置,用戶需要根據(jù)自己的需要提前對(duì)過濾規(guī)則進(jìn)行設(shè)置;(4)對(duì)數(shù)據(jù)包進(jìn)行捕獲;(5)對(duì)數(shù)據(jù)包進(jìn)行解析,在捕獲到符合要求的數(shù)據(jù)包之后,并不能夠直接獲取所感興趣的信息,而是需要進(jìn)行相應(yīng)的處理;(6)結(jié)束工作,在完成數(shù)據(jù)包捕獲工作之后,需要結(jié)束響應(yīng)的程序,關(guān)閉會(huì)話以釋放資源。

三、結(jié)語

基于不同技術(shù)的數(shù)據(jù)包捕獲技術(shù)其實(shí)現(xiàn)的具體方式也不相同,但是數(shù)據(jù)包捕獲的基本原理與工作流程都是基本相同的。通過對(duì)數(shù)據(jù)包捕獲技術(shù)的分析能夠更好的實(shí)現(xiàn)網(wǎng)絡(luò)流量捕獲,進(jìn)而為網(wǎng)絡(luò)分析提供更加可靠的依據(jù)。

參考文獻(xiàn)

[1] 王月輝.基于WinPcap的網(wǎng)絡(luò)數(shù)據(jù)捕獲和分析系統(tǒng)的研究與實(shí)現(xiàn)[D].沈陽:沈陽工業(yè)大學(xué),2007.

[2] 張偉,等.基于WinPcap的數(shù)據(jù)包捕獲及應(yīng)用[J].計(jì)算機(jī)工程與設(shè)計(jì),2008,29(7):1649-1651.

主站蜘蛛池模板: 久久久久免费看成人影片| 国产特级毛片| 国产高清精品在线91| 欧美一区中文字幕| 日本五区在线不卡精品| 欧美日韩国产在线人| 波多野结衣二区| 国产小视频免费观看| 国产不卡在线看| 一级一级一片免费| 国产69精品久久久久孕妇大杂乱 | 欧美伊人色综合久久天天| 玩两个丰满老熟女久久网| 国产免费人成视频网| 极品av一区二区| 亚洲色大成网站www国产| 综合色区亚洲熟妇在线| 区国产精品搜索视频| 亚洲av无码人妻| 国产丰满成熟女性性满足视频 | 久久无码av三级| 小说区 亚洲 自拍 另类| 久久人人爽人人爽人人片aV东京热| 尤物成AV人片在线观看| 国产av一码二码三码无码| 亚洲国产综合精品一区| 激情无码字幕综合| 日本精品αv中文字幕| 人妻无码中文字幕一区二区三区| 毛片免费在线视频| 久久精品最新免费国产成人| 国产原创演绎剧情有字幕的| 久草视频福利在线观看| 欧美综合区自拍亚洲综合天堂| 国产黑丝一区| 成人午夜亚洲影视在线观看| 国产欧美日韩专区发布| 亚洲成aⅴ人在线观看| 先锋资源久久| 亚洲人成网址| 国产99视频免费精品是看6| 久久精品国产91久久综合麻豆自制| 精品综合久久久久久97超人| 丁香五月婷婷激情基地| 中文字幕 日韩 欧美| 国产精品成人久久| 国产精品无码AⅤ在线观看播放| 国产成人超碰无码| 久久久受www免费人成| 波多野结衣国产精品| 久久网综合| 亚洲福利视频网址| 日韩黄色大片免费看| 亚洲精品福利网站| 久久精品日日躁夜夜躁欧美| 91欧美亚洲国产五月天| 欧美黄网站免费观看| 亚洲精品视频网| 无码一区二区波多野结衣播放搜索| 亚洲乱码视频| 亚洲av成人无码网站在线观看| 五月六月伊人狠狠丁香网| 国产高清在线丝袜精品一区| 色婷婷在线播放| 免费国产在线精品一区| 国产99欧美精品久久精品久久 | 亚洲国产成人精品一二区| 91精品伊人久久大香线蕉| 青青青视频免费一区二区| 欧美丝袜高跟鞋一区二区| 国产对白刺激真实精品91| 亚洲欧美日韩久久精品| 任我操在线视频| 日本亚洲最大的色成网站www| 欧美亚洲一二三区| 色综合天天娱乐综合网| 国产极品粉嫩小泬免费看| 在线免费无码视频| 色噜噜狠狠色综合网图区| 亚洲人成影院午夜网站| 国产高潮视频在线观看| 中文字幕色站|